Shingles Vaccine: Who Should Get It and When
Jan 16, 2026 / 13 Comments
Shingrix is the only shingles vaccine available in the U.S. and is recommended for adults 50 and older. Learn who should get it, when to get the second dose, what side effects to expect, and how it compares to the old vaccine.
